# Build Provenance — Fuelgauge Fleet Reports

The weekly fuel-usage report for the Ashvale depot fleet is generated by the Fuelgauge batch job. Every run is reproducible: inputs are pinned telemetry snapshots, outputs are signed. On call? Don't regenerate manually — rerun the pipeline so provenance stays intact. Verify the report you're inspecting matches the pipeline run before escalating discrepancies. The current production run is identified by the token below.

session token of kageg-tahop = htk14_af3c1ccccb7dcf

Management Meeting Minutes — Reseller Programme

Present: Dena Forsgate, Ollie Rennick, Priya Calloway.

Quick recap: the Fernlight reseller programme is tracking ahead of plan — 14 partners signed versus the 10 we'd hoped for. Margins are a bit thinner than modelled, mostly down to the tiered discount we offered early joiners. Ollie will tighten the discount bands before the next intake. Where we want to take the programme next is covered in the note below.

board note of yahip-tadug: Headcount on the Zorath team goes from 9 to 100 by the end of April. Gross margin on Zorath came in at 10 percent against a plan of 20 percent.

**Q: Can I use the lifts during weekend maintenance?**

Lifts at Harrow Dene House are serviced Saturdays 22:00–04:00. Night shift staff should use the north stairwell during this window; the goods lift stays live for emergencies only. The stairwell doors lock automatically after 21:00 and can be opened with the code shown below.

door code, yagap-bahof: bdg-O-05